Louisiana DOTD Announces Lane Closure on I-10 Eastbound in Vinton for Shoulder Reconstruction

By Calcasieu Staff

Published August 07, 2024

Vinton, Louisiana - The Louisiana Department of Transportation and Development has announced a lane closure on Interstate 10 Eastbound in Vinton, which is expected to affect traffic flow in the region. Starting from 7 p.m. on Monday, August 12, 2024, the right lane of I-10 Eastbound will be closed from Mile Marker 8.5 (Exit 8) to Mile Marker 10. The closure is scheduled to last until 6 a.m. on Monday, August 19, 2024.

The primary reason for this closure is to facilitate shoulder reconstruction work. During this period, motorists are advised to plan ahead and consider alternative routes to avoid congestion.

For those traveling eastbound on I-10, there are two recommended detour routes. The first option involves exiting onto US 90 at Exit 4, heading north, and then turning right onto US 90 going east. From there, motorists can turn right onto LA 27 in Sulphur and use the on-ramp to re-enter I-10 Eastbound. The second option involves exiting onto LA 3063 at Exit 7, heading north, and then turning right onto US 90 going east. Again, motorists can turn right onto LA 27 in Sulphur and use the on-ramp to re-enter I-10 Eastbound.
